Squeezing Everything I can out of 60lb Injectors on E47

Had some fun today with the TVS Cobalt. Just thought I'd share the results of some experimentation.

Mods:
ZZP Midlength Header, 3" DP with Cat.
3" Hahn Catback, no Resonator.
Some 2.75" CAI.
Siemens 60lbs Injectors, using correct IFR table (1.3x multiplier to stoich)
Dual-Pass, Option B, ZZP S3 Heat Exchanger.
BKR7E Coppers Gapped 0.030"
TVS-1320 with 3.15" Pulley.
FE5 suspension and some Shitty TTR motor mounts
STOCK clutch (Yes it slips on shifts, causes KR because of the Vibs occasionally)

Fuel: 50% 91 octane Gasoline, 50% E85 summer blend
Timing: 25 - 27.5 deg advance during WOT
Fuel Cutoff: 7250rpm
IDC: 101% @7200rpm
MAF Freq: 10,300 @7200rpm
Boost: 20psi @7200rpm
Dynamic: 3600rpm Disable



Owner is putting 80s, Fuel pump, BRFPS, and going FULL E85 very soon, then time to experiment with smaller pulleys.

Thing pulls like a beast
